A man has been accused of murder in connection with the reported stabbing of a man on New Year’s Eve.
Anthony Junior Murray, aged 25 and residing on Tarn Drive in Bury, has been formally charged with murder and possessing a bladed item, as confirmed by the Greater Manchester Police (GMP) in a recent announcement. Mr. Murray has been detained in custody and is scheduled to appear before Manchester Magistrates Court later today.
Joe Burton, a 24-year-old man identified in legal documents, tragically lost his life at the scene. The GMP has stated that inquiries into the incident are ongoing.
Photos taken at Tarn Drive depict a section of the street still cordoned off. A forensic tent has been set up, and investigators are collecting photographic evidence.
A woman in her twenties was taken into custody on suspicion of murder, although she has been released on bail pending further investigation.
